Output 269260d650ccff51e8a16bdc035f2a0b4e334f0c29eb23e2fe3ce7cc5efcc774:0

value
1880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e82c82eccc36238c367e5082d88b7e5c8f20d5ea OP_EQUAL
address
3Nre1kq66UPphgRg8HPWDYz4Wa8RcaDoLm
transaction
269260d650ccff51e8a16bdc035f2a0b4e334f0c29eb23e2fe3ce7cc5efcc774
confirmations
346004
spent
true